House Tuckpointing in Cleveland, OH
House tuckpointing services involve repairing and restoring the mortar joints between bricks or stones on a building’s exterior. This process is essential for maintaining the structural integrity and appearance of a property, especially in areas like Cleveland, OH where weather conditions can accelerate mortar deterioration. Projects typically include removing damaged mortar, cleaning the joints, and applying fresh mortar to ensure the wall remains durable and visually appealing. Homeowners often seek tuckpointing to address issues such as crumbling mortar, cracked joints, or signs of water infiltration, which can lead to more significant damage if left unattended.
Before requesting tuckpointing services, property owners usually want to understand the scope of work needed, including the extent of mortar deterioration and whether any underlying issues, like moisture damage or brick deterioration, should be addressed simultaneously. It’s also helpful to know the types of mortar used and how closely the new mortar will match the existing material for a seamless appearance. Proper assessment and planning can help ensure the repair enhances both the longevity and curb appeal of the property.

Common House Tuckpointing Jobs
Brick and mortar repair - restoring the appearance and stability of existing brickwork.
Repointing services - replacing deteriorated mortar joints to prevent water infiltration.
Cement joint restoration - renewing mortar between bricks to maintain structural integrity.
Chimney tuckpointing - addressing cracks and deterioration around chimneys for safety and durability.
Foundation wall tuckpointing - reinforcing foundation walls to prevent shifting and damage.
Historic masonry restoration - preserving the original look of older brickwork through careful tuckpointing.
House Tuckpointing Questions
What is tuckpointing? Tuckpointing involves removing damaged mortar and replacing it to restore the appearance and integrity of brick or stone walls.
When should tuckpointing be considered? Tuckpointing is recommended when mortar joints show signs of cracking, crumbling, or deterioration.
What types of projects benefit from tuckpointing? Tuckpointing is suitable for historic buildings, brick facades, chimneys, and retaining walls needing repair.
How does tuckpointing improve a property? It enhances curb appeal and helps prevent water infiltration that can cause structural damage.
